首页> 游戏动态 >ao3怎么切中文?中文切分方法详解!

ao3怎么切中文?中文切分方法详解!

2025-06-16 18:01:48

  在处理文本数据时,中文切分是一个关键步骤,它涉及到将连续的中文文本分割成有意义的词或短语。AO3(Archive of Our Own)是一个基于WordPress的在线创作社区,它允许用户上传和分享各种类型的创作作品。对于中文内容,正确的切分方法能够提高搜索效率、文本分析和机器翻译的准确性。本文将详细介绍AO3中文切分的方法,并探讨如何实现有效的中文切分。

  一、中文切分的重要性

  中文切分是自然语言处理(NLP)中的一个基本任务,它对于文本分析、信息检索、机器翻译等应用至关重要。以下是中文切分的重要性:

  1. 提高搜索效率:通过切分,可以将文本分解成有意义的词或短语,从而提高搜索系统的匹配精度和效率。

  2. 便于文本分析:切分后的文本可以方便地进行词频统计、词性标注等分析任务。

  3. 优化机器翻译:在机器翻译过程中,切分后的文本可以更好地理解原文的含义,提高翻译质量。

  二、中文切分方法详解

  1. 基于规则的方法

  基于规则的方法是通过定义一系列规则,对文本进行切分。以下是一些常见的规则:

  (1)最大匹配法:从左到右扫描文本,每次尽可能匹配最长的词,直到无法匹配为止。

  (2)最小匹配法:从左到右扫描文本,每次尽可能匹配最短的词,直到无法匹配为止。

  (3)双向最大匹配法:从左到右和从右到左分别进行最大匹配,取两者中匹配长度较长的一个。

  (4)双向最小匹配法:从左到右和从右到左分别进行最小匹配,取两者中匹配长度较长的一个。

  2. 基于统计的方法

  基于统计的方法是通过分析大量语料库,学习文本的切分模式。以下是一些常见的统计方法:

  (1)隐马尔可夫模型(HMM):HMM是一种概率模型,可以用于中文切分。通过训练,HMM可以学习到文本的切分模式。

  (2)条件随机场(CRF):CRF是一种基于概率的图模型,可以用于中文切分。通过训练,CRF可以学习到文本的切分模式。

  (3)支持向量机(SVM):SVM是一种监督学习方法,可以用于中文切分。通过训练,SVM可以学习到文本的切分模式。

  3. 基于深度学习的方法

  基于深度学习的方法是近年来兴起的一种中文切分方法。以下是一些常见的深度学习方法:

  (1)循环神经网络(RNN):RNN是一种基于序列的神经网络,可以用于中文切分。通过训练,RNN可以学习到文本的切分模式。

  (2)长短时记忆网络(LSTM):LSTM是一种特殊的RNN,可以用于处理长序列数据。在中文切分中,LSTM可以学习到文本的切分模式。

  (3)卷积神经网络(CNN):CNN是一种局部感知的神经网络,可以用于中文切分。通过训练,CNN可以学习到文本的切分模式。

  三、AO3中文切分实践

  在AO3平台上,中文内容的切分可以通过以下步骤实现:

  1. 收集AO3中文语料库:从AO3平台上收集大量中文创作作品,作为训练和测试数据。

  2. 数据预处理:对收集到的中文语料库进行预处理,包括去除无关信息、去除停用词等。

  3. 选择切分方法:根据实际需求,选择合适的中文切分方法,如HMM、CRF或LSTM等。

  4. 训练模型:使用预处理后的数据,对选定的切分方法进行训练。

  5. 模型评估:使用测试数据对训练好的模型进行评估,调整模型参数,提高切分精度。

  6. 应用模型:将训练好的模型应用于AO3平台上的中文内容,实现自动切分。

  四、相关问答

  1. 问:中文切分有哪些常见错误?

  答:常见的错误包括过度切分(将一个词切分成多个词)和欠切分(将两个词合并成一个词)。此外,还有切分位置不准确等问题。

  2. 问:如何提高中文切分的准确性?

  答:提高中文切分的准确性可以通过以下方法实现:使用高质量的语料库进行训练,选择合适的切分方法,不断优化模型参数,以及进行充分的测试和评估。

  3. 问:中文切分在AO3平台上的应用有哪些?

  答:在AO3平台上,中文切分可以应用于搜索优化、文本分析和机器翻译等方面,提高用户体验和平台功能。

  4. 问:基于深度学习的中文切分方法有哪些优势?

  答:基于深度学习的中文切分方法具有以下优势:能够自动学习文本的切分模式,具有较强的泛化能力,能够处理复杂文本结构。

  通过以上方法,我们可以有效地对AO3平台上的中文内容进行切分,提高文本处理的效率和准确性。